About Shuanhu Zhou
Shuanhu Zhou is a scholar working on Molecular Biology, Genetics, Pathology and Forensic Medicine, Oncology and Neurology, having authored 77 papers that have together received 4.4k indexed citations. Recurring topics across this work include Mesenchymal stem cell research (15 papers), Vitamin D Research Studies (14 papers), Bone health and osteoporosis research (10 papers), Amyotrophic Lateral Sclerosis Research (9 papers), Bone Metabolism and Diseases (9 papers), Bone health and treatments (9 papers), TGF-β signaling in diseases (6 papers) and Wnt/β-catenin signaling in development and cancer (5 papers). The work is most often cited by research in Genetics (883 citations), Orthopedics and Sports Medicine (392 citations), Biological Psychiatry (101 citations), Urology (211 citations) and Endocrine and Autonomic Systems (235 citations). Shuanhu Zhou has collaborated with scholars based in United States, China and Israel. Frequent co-authors include Julie Glowacki, Meryl S. LeBoff, Joel S. Greenberger, Michael W. Epperly, Dan Gazit, Julie P. Goff, Carolyn E. Adler, Yoram Zilberman, Karim Eid and Gadi Turgeman. Their work appears in journals such as Journal of Cellular Biochemistry, The Journal of Steroid Biochemistry and Molecular Biology, Cells, Journal of Bone and Mineral Research and Experimental Hematology.
